hello tutor, I need help with my question how do i find an equation of the ellipse having the given foci and sum of focal radii? thank you! :)
\n" ); document.write( "(0,0), (0,8);12

\n" ); document.write( "Standard form of equation for an ellipse with vertical major axis: (x-h)^2/b^2+(y-k)^2/a^2=1, a>b, (h,k)=(x,y) coordinates of center.
\n" ); document.write( "..
\n" ); document.write( "For given ellipse
\n" ); document.write( "x-coordinate of center=0
\n" ); document.write( "y-coordinate of center=(8+0)/2=4 (midpoint formula)
\n" ); document.write( "center: (0,4)
\n" ); document.write( "Sum of focal radii=12=2a:
\n" ); document.write( "a=6
\n" ); document.write( "a^2=36
\n" ); document.write( "..
\n" ); document.write( "foci=8=2c
\n" ); document.write( "c=4
\n" ); document.write( "c^2=16
\n" ); document.write( "..
\n" ); document.write( "c^2=a^2-b^2
\n" ); document.write( "b^2=a^2-c^2=36-16=20
\n" ); document.write( "Equation:
\n" ); document.write( "x^2/20+(y-4)^2/36=1
